Injustice 2 Brings Back The Joker

The latest trailer for the upcoming fighting game, Injustice 2, spotlights and highlights a villain a lot of people hoped would return but wasn't sure would make an appearance: The Joker. So why all the question marks over why he's back? Because he's supposed to be dead.

Within two continuities of the Batman universe, the Joker is dead. In the Injustice universe Joker is supposed to be dead, and in Rocksteady's Batman: Arkham series the Joker is dead. Well, as made evident in the trailer above that was posted up recently on the official Injustice YouTube channel, the Joker is alive and very dangerous.

So how is the clown prince of crime back at it again? Well, _spoilers ahead for those of you who didn't play the original Injustice, or only have a cursory knowledge of it, the Joker was killed in the first five minutes by Superman because he tricked Superman into killing Lois and her unborn child. Superman lost it and ripped out the Joker's heart... Mortal Kombat_ style.

Superman ended up establishing his Regime based on the Joker's actions that led to the deaths of countless innocent people. However, in the other Earth multiverse, the other Joker was still alive and still played a small part in the events that unfolded in the story of the original Injustice.

It's completely possible that the Joker we see in the trailer above is either from a different Earth dimension, or -- some are speculating in the comment section -- this is a specter or ghost of the Joker and he only appears in dreams or flashback sequences, similar to how he was portrayed in Batman: Arkham Knight.

Regardless of how well he fits into the story of Injustice 2, a lot of people are heaping a lot of praise on NetherRealm for being able to capture some element of Jared Leto's Joker from Suicide Squad without including the more unsavory aspects of his Joker, such as the ridiculous tattoos and piercings.

The jacket and color of the jacket obviously is a nod to Leto's portrayal of the character. Instead of having tattoos spread across his body, however, he has fresh blood written across his stomach that says "Ha".

There's definitely a disturbing and unhinged element to this portrayal of the Joker. He still has a cache of gadgets and gag props, but they're quite inventive, such as the prop gun that actually fires an explosive "Bang!" flag at opponents, or his combo buzzer on his hands that can be used in a variety of ways.

NetherRealm didn't just pull from Leto's Suicide Squad character for Injustice 2, though. There's also a nod to Heath Ledger's Joker portrayal from The Dark Knight, with the character in the game having a selection of different pocket knife attacks and pipe attacks, both of which were used in the film by Ledger. They even manage to throw a nod to Jack Nicholson's Joker, who relied on his green laughing gas to kill people.

And finally, Joker's super special in Injustice 2 sees the psychotic criminal strapping his opponent to the chair and taking a crowbar across their face, a nod to the very graphic and unforgettable death of Jason Todd at the hands of the Joker.

A lot of people definitely like what NetherRealm have done with the character and there are a lot of nods to both the character's comic book and silver screen adaptations.
